Spark

Marooned on an Island I seek comfort in the dark,
Someone to takeaway the shadows with a spark.

A life sentenceĀ I seem destined to be alone,
All i really want is a family and a home.

To wake up on Christmas Morning and see the spark in my children's eyes,
unwrapping presents in wonder and surprise.

A legacy in my children will always remain,
to know il always be there for them through happiness and pain.

To find somebody to share cold winter nights,
who will stick by me through the love and the fights.

I do not seek a million dollars or eternal health,
for my gold is in people and my family will be my wealth.

I await the day until I find the Spark,
for she will be the one, to take away the shadows and the dark.

Eamon Doolan (c)
